What Steps Are Involved in Replacing the Fuel Pump in a 2001 IS300?
To replace the fuel pump in a 2001 IS300, follow these steps:
- Disconnect the battery.
- Relieve the fuel system pressure.
- Remove the rear seats.
- Take out the access cover.
- Disconnect the fuel pump electrical connector.
- Disconnect the fuel lines.
- Remove the fuel pump assembly.
- Install the new fuel pump assembly.
- Reconnect the fuel lines and electrical connector.
- Reinstall the access cover and rear seats.
- Reconnect the battery.

What Common Problems Can I Expect With the Fuel Pump in a 2001 IS300?
Common problems with the fuel pump in a 2001 IS300 include the following:
- Fuel pump failure
- Insufficient fuel pressure
- Fuel pump noise
- Clogged fuel filter
- Electrical issues
- Contaminated fuel
- Vapor lock
Understanding these problems can help in diagnosing issues effectively.
-
Fuel Pump Failure: Fuel pump failure typically occurs due to wear and tear or electrical malfunctions. This issue leads to engine stalling or failure to start. According to a study by J.D. Power in 2021, failing fuel pumps are a common issue in vehicles older than 15 years. Symptoms can include a lack of fuel delivery, causing the engine to cut off while driving.
-
Insufficient Fuel Pressure: Insufficient fuel pressure happens when the pump cannot provide the necessary fuel flow to the engine. This can lead to poor engine performance or misfires. The typical fuel pressure for the IS300 should be around 43 psi. If it drops below this threshold, the engine may struggle to start or run smoothly.
-
Fuel Pump Noise: Fuel pump noise may indicate impending failure. A subtle humming sound is normal, but loud whining can suggest problems. Mechanics, such as those at AAA, advise that excessive noise often reveals wear on the internal components or an impending failure.
-
Clogged Fuel Filter: A clogged fuel filter can restrict fuel flow, leading to reduced performance. Regularly replacing the fuel filter can help maintain optimal engine performance. The IS300’s fuel filter should generally be changed every 30,000 miles to prevent clogs.
-
Electrical Issues: Electrical issues can affect fuel pump functionality. This includes failed relays, blown fuses, or wiring shorts. A failed relay can stop power from reaching the fuel pump entirely, resulting in engine performance issues or failure to start.
-
Contaminated Fuel: Contaminated fuel can damage fuel system components and leads to pump failure. Water, dirt, and sediments in the fuel can cause significant issues. Keeping fuel tanks clean and using quality fuel can help avoid this problem.
-
Vapor Lock: Vapor lock occurs when fuel vaporizes in the fuel line, interrupting fuel flow. This is more common in high temperatures and can lead to stalling. Ensuring proper ventilation in the engine compartment can minimize this risk.
By recognizing these issues, you can effectively manage and maintain the fuel system in your 2001 IS300.
